On Wed, May 21, 2014 at 01:16:38PM -0400, Paul DiSciascio wrote: > I've posted my problem to the dovecot mailing list, but i'm not sure > how well it will be received since Trusty appears to be using a > version not maintained by that project (but maybe i'm interpreting > this wrong). > > Here is the actual problem description: > http://www.dovecot.org/list/dovecot/2014-May/096236.html > > Since this list is considered the package maintainer for > dovecot-antispam, I was wondering if anyone could shed some light on > the packaging choices here and where I might go for additional help.
We're synced with Debian on dovecot-antispam - both in Trusty and in Utopic. It might be worth reproducing this issue in Debian (eg. in a container), and if it does reproduce, then raising this with the Debian maintainer for dovecot-antispam (from a Debian perspective). Robie
